Abstract

Today, industry has been exposed to Industrial Revolution 4.0 (IR4.0) which will change matters in the future. Its combination of cyber-physical systems and the Internet of Things (IoT). In this project, industrial machine namely as MAP202 is selected to implement the control and monitoring system using Supervisory, Control and Data Acquisition (SCADA) and IoT application .. It's been used for controlled and monitored as MAP202 is adapted from real implementation in industrial manufacturing. The main idea of this project is to monitor using IoT application with NodeMCU and develop an industrial control and monitoring system for integrate with the current system using SCADA. Generally, this system can supervise the MAP202 wirelessly and also the PLC wiring can be done to a different types of external input or output devices. In order to design the operation of the system based on real implementation in industrial manufacturing. Ladder diagram with four conditions of the movement are developed by using Grafcet technique. The condition is about checking the presence of the object and the decision making for the correct movements. They are also included alarm to indicate there is an error occurred during the operation. Moreover, this project can be monitored online through Internet of Things (IoT) implementation with NodeMCU. This project also integrates with existing system using Microsoft Visual Basic as a SCAD A system.
